39 lines
1.2 KiB
Plaintext
39 lines
1.2 KiB
Plaintext
|
# openssl req -new -utf8 -nameopt multiline,utf8 -config Dokumente/git/dexus-pem/test/fixtures/cn_openssl_config.conf -newkey rsa:2048 -nodes -keyout Dokumente/git/dexus-pem/test/fixtures/cn_openssl.key -out Dokumente/git/dexus-pem/test/fixtures/cn_openssl.csr
|
||
|
# openssl req -x509 -newkey rsa:4096 -sha256 -utf8 -days 365 -nodes \
|
||
|
-config Dokumente/git/dexus-pem/test/fixtures/cn_openssl_config.conf \
|
||
|
-keyout Dokumente/git/dexus-pem/test/fixtures/cn_openssl.key \
|
||
|
-out Dokumente/git/dexus-pem/test/fixtures/cn_openssl.crt
|
||
|
|
||
|
HOME = .
|
||
|
RANDFILE = $ENV::HOME/.rnd
|
||
|
|
||
|
[CA_default]
|
||
|
copy_extensions = copy
|
||
|
|
||
|
[req]
|
||
|
default_bits = 4096
|
||
|
prompt = no
|
||
|
string_mask = utf8only
|
||
|
utf8 = yes
|
||
|
default_md = sha256
|
||
|
distinguished_name = dn
|
||
|
x509_extensions = v3_ca
|
||
|
|
||
|
[dn]
|
||
|
CN = 中国银行 # Site description
|
||
|
emailAddress = envek@envek.name
|
||
|
O = 法兰克福分行 # My company
|
||
|
OU = 克福分 # My dept
|
||
|
L = 兰克福 # Moscow
|
||
|
C = RU
|
||
|
|
||
|
[v3_ca]
|
||
|
basicConstraints = CA:FALSE
|
||
|
keyUsage = digitalSignature, keyEncipherment
|
||
|
subjectAltName = @alternate_names
|
||
|
|
||
|
[alternate_names]
|
||
|
DNS.1 = example.com
|
||
|
DNS.2 = *.app.example.com
|
||
|
DNS.3 = www.example.com
|